Apple iPhone 7 - New Concept Or Killer Upgrade


Apple iPhone 7 is scheduled to be released later this year and the company has to capitalize on opportunity to introduce moderate upgrade.
According to the planet’s best Apple analyst, Ming-Chi Kuo of KGI Securities, the tech company is paving the way for a substantial reconstruction with the 2017 iPhone, which is more likely to be dubbed as iPhone 7s or iPhone 8. The modernized smartphone structure will have few changes and it will adopt a casing with metal and glass fusion instead of complete metal. Additionally, it is proposed to include wireless charging, extra biometric functions, and more.
This precisely sounds like the significant overhaul, which might have been anticipated with the version of iPhone that is set to be launched later this year. Remarkably, the mere projection that the CupertinoCalif. firm is gearing up to bring a change to the 2017 iPhone has allowed both – Apple watchers the investors – to question whether iPhone 7 will eventually turn out to be a minor update of iPhone 6s.
Motley Fool analysts, however, envisions that apparently the anticipated iPhone 7 may end up looking like iPhone 6s slimmer version with less annoying antenna, even then it has a lot of potential to be demonstrated as a significant enhancement from the 6s. Following are some of the reasons, which the analysts believe will substantially upgrade iPhone 7 from the preceding device.
Both the 6s and 6s Plus display features are in the urgent need of some modifications. Even though the exceptional alternative, which the 2017 iPhone might have, is the huge transition to an OLED display, according to Kuo, the company has the capability to upgrade the display while having the traditional LCD technology.
Analysts expect the following upgrade in the devices’ display: improved contrast ratio, low screen light reflectance, wider color gamut for richer, more vivid colors; True Tone technology – for more natural look of the images, and higher display resolution which can provide greater sharpness.
Apple’s latest 9.7-inch iPad Pro has already demonstrated four out of five upgrade. It is an open secret that iPhone holds more importance for Apple than the iPad; therefore, it is likely that the latter’s technologies step into the iPhone.
Apple is not shifting the entire focus on making the screens better. The U.S. tech leviathan will certainly work on upgrading multiple key technologies. Analysts expect the organization to launch a third generation Touch ID, which will be faster than the already lightning speed Touch found in the preceding device.
More importantly, Apple is gearing up to essentially upgrade the camera for iPhone 7 series. Sources privy to the matter has leaked that the iPhone 7 will have larger frame, meaning that the company will be deploying a larger sensor than the one in the iPhone 6/6s. Moreover, the larger screen smartphone will be accompanied with both single and dual camera lens configuration.
Lastly, the most valuable company will be deploying A10 processor, which will run faster and have more memory. The current iPhones are world class as well but for the first time in a very long time, the company witnessed the slow rate of growth in the sale of its core product. Therefore, the company has to actively watch out for the “golden opportunities” through which the business can bring about appropriate changes and demonstrate the iPhone 7 as a top-notch product.
